1. 默认壁纸在系统源码里是放在device/amlogic/f24ref_l/overlay/frameworks/base/core/res/res/drawable-large-nodpi 和 drawable-xlarge-nodpi下的default_wallpaper.jpg,另外,进入设置时默认的黑色背景,放在device/amlogic/f24ref_l/overlay/frameworks/base/core/res/res/drawable-nodpi/backgroud_holo_dark.jpg。更换完这些图片,系统要clean掉重新编译,比较费时间。
2.在调试阶段,想先快速看下效果,决定用哪张图片,可以用下面的方法不编译直接替换图片:
a. 通过adb pull从机器里读取/system/framework/framework-res.apk
b. 用rar打开,替换res/drawable_*下相关的图片,然后关掉rar
c. 通过adb push把framework-res.apk重新push到 /system/framework/ 下面
d. 重启机器,就可以了
本文介绍了一种在Android系统中不经过重新编译即可快速替换默认壁纸和其他背景图片的方法,适用于开发过程中的快速预览需求。
1万+

被折叠的 条评论
为什么被折叠?



